Clinical Evaluation of Full Contour Zirconia Chairside CAD/CAM Crowns
NCT06173167 · Status: R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 70
Last updated 2024-03-28
Summary
This investigation will be a randomized, prospective, longitudinal clinical trial to study the clinical performance of a new monolithic, zirconia material with shade, translucency and material graduation for chairside CAD/CAM crowns. The restorations will be luted either with a self-adhesive luting material or a conventional cement. The crowns will be evaluated for a period of two years.

Interventions
- DEVICE
-
Crowns self-adhesively luted
After cavity preparation, the zirconia chairside crown will be placed using SpeedCEM Plus. The excess will be light cured with Bluephase G4 in PreCure mode (950 mW/cm\^2). After removal of the excess, the luting material margins will be light-cured again for 20s (1200 mW/cm\^2).
- DEVICE
-
Crowns conventionally cemented
After cavity preparation, the zirconia chairside crown will be placed using ZirCAD Cement. The excess cement will be removed in the gel phase, either following light curing (5 - 10 seconds per segment) or following self-curing (approximately 2 min after placement). The restoration will be held in position during final curing that is complete 4 min 30 s after placement.
